Description
Chateau Haut Brisson 2025 exemplifies the finest qualities of Saint-Émilion’s prestigious terroir, cultivated on the region’s distinctive clay-limestone soils. This exceptional vintage embodies the hallmark depth and richness characteristic of the Right Bank, presenting a wine that balances power with elegance.
Steered by the Kressmann family, renowned Bordeaux négociants with a multi-generational heritage, Château Haut-Brisson has risen to prominence as an impressive Grand Cru. It delivers remarkable quality rivaling more prominent neighboring estates, yet remains accessible at a fraction of the cost. The 2025 vintage displays superb concentration and harmony, reflecting both the estate’s dedication to excellence and the unique attributes of its vineyard site.
Offered as part of an exclusive En Primeur release, this pre-release opportunity allows collectors and connoisseurs to secure one of Bordeaux’s most coveted wines prior to bottling. Expected to arrive in Australia by late 2028, the Chateau Haut Brisson 2025 presents a rare chance to obtain a top-tier Saint-Émilion vintage directly from the source well in advance.
The wine is renowned for its intense bouquet of ripe black fruits, nuanced by subtle spice and a refined minerality. On the palate, it reveals a plush texture with velvety tannins and a long, persistent finish. The 2025 vintage benefits from favourable climatic conditions across Bordeaux, enhancing grape ripeness and complexity, and promising outstanding aging potential.
